Analysis

Kuwait recorded 0.14 mg/cap/d for miscellaneous — riboflavin supply — value in 2023.

That represents a change of down 12.5% on the previous year and up 16.7% over ten years.

Over the whole period, miscellaneous — riboflavin supply — value in Kuwait peaked at 0.16 mg/cap/d in 2022 and was at its lowest, 0.1 mg/cap/d, in 2018.

That places Kuwait 32nd out of 166 countries with data for 2023, putting it in the top quarter.

The long-run direction has been consistently rising across the 14 years of available data.

The dataset presents average daily per capita macro and micro nutrient availability by country and by FAO/WHO GIFT food groups (that are different from those used for the Food Balance Sheets), expressed in grams/milligrams/micrograms/kcal per capita per day. The population numbers used to calculate these statistics can be found in the Supply Utilization Accounts (SUA) dataset of FAOSTAT, as Total Population. Food availability quantities are derived from the SUA dataset. SUAs present a comprehensive picture of the pattern of a country's food supply and utilization during a specified reference period. The SUA shows for each food item - i.e. each primary commodity and a number of processed commodities potentially available for human consumption - the sources of supply and its utilization. The total quantity of foodstuffs produced in a country added to the total quantity imported and adjusted to any change in stocks that may have occurred since the beginning of the reference period gives the supply available during that period. On the utilization side a distinction is made between the quantities exported, fed to livestock, used for seed, put to manufacture for food use and non-food uses, losses during storage and transportation, and food supplies available for human consumption. The per capita supply of each such food item available for human consumption is then obtained by dividing the respective quantity by the related data on the population actually partaking of it.
